        <description>Welcome to Songs That Sound Like Other Songs

This is the obviously personal website of William Meyer (me), that brings together two of my favorite subjects: music and people. (Well, not people, cause I listen to music as a way of avoiding people, but music at least!) In an earlier version it was just songs that sounded like other songs, but that was too limiting so I threw it open to the whole of the human condition! -- the way songs speak to us, what songs mean, what we want them to mean, ...</description>
